Python基础教程:数据类型、Indentation和基本操作
需积分: 10 100 浏览量
更新于2024-07-18
收藏 2.22MB PDF 举报
Python基础知识点总结
Python是一种高级的、解释性的编程语言,它可以应用于各种领域,如数据分析、人工智能、网络开发等。以下是Python基础知识点的总结:
**变量和赋值**
* 在Python中,变量不需要声明类型,可以直接赋值。
* 使用赋值符号(=)来将值赋给变量。
* 变量的类型是动态的,对象的类型决定了变量的类型。
**数据类型**
* 整数(int):默认的数字类型,例如:`x = 5`
* 浮点数(float):例如:`x = 3.456`
* 字符串(string):可以使用双引号或单引号定义,例如:`x = "hello"` 或 `x = 'hello'`
* 序列类型:包括列表(list)、元组(tuple)和字符串(string)
**序列类型**
* 列表(list):可以修改的序列类型,例如:`x = [1, 2, 3]`
* 元组(tuple):不可修改的序列类型,例如:`x = (1, 2, 3)`
* 字符串(string):不可修改的序列类型,例如:`x = "hello"`
**可变性**
* 在Python中,变量的可变性是指变量的值是否可以修改。
* 可变类型包括列表(list)和字典(dict),不可变类型包括整数(int)、浮点数(float)和字符串(string)。
**引用语义**
* 在Python中,变量的赋值操作实际上是将对象的引用赋值给变量。
* 例如:`x = 5`实际上是将整数对象5的引用赋值给变量x。
**控制流**
* 在Python中,控制流语句包括if语句、for语句和while语句。
* 例如:`if x > 5: print("x is greater than 5")`
**字符串操作**
* 字符串可以使用+号进行连接,例如:`x = "hello" + "world"`
* 字符串可以使用%号进行格式化,例如:`x = "my name is %s" % "John"`
**基本打印命令**
* 在Python中,基本打印命令是print()函数,例如:`print("hello world")`
**缩进和代码块**
* 在Python中,缩进是用来定义代码块的。
* 缩进可以使用空格或制表符,但是一般情况下使用四个空格。
**注释**
* 在Python中,注释可以使用#号,例如:`x = 5 # this is a comment`
**基本运算符**
* 在Python中,基本运算符包括+、-、\*、/、%等。
* 例如:`x = 5 + 3`将输出8。
Python基础知识点包括变量和赋值、数据类型、序列类型、可变性、引用语义、控制流、字符串操作、基本打印命令、缩进和代码块、注释和基本运算符等。
2019-11-04 上传
2018-09-01 上传
2023-06-07 上传
2023-06-07 上传
2023-08-31 上传
2023-04-28 上传
2023-05-27 上传
2023-06-08 上传
tangmiaomiaowu
- 粉丝: 1
- 资源: 7
最新资源
- zlib-1.2.12压缩包解析与技术要点
- 微信小程序滑动选项卡源码模版发布
- Unity虚拟人物唇同步插件Oculus Lipsync介绍
- Nginx 1.18.0版本WinSW自动安装与管理指南
- Java Swing和JDBC实现的ATM系统源码解析
- 掌握Spark Streaming与Maven集成的分布式大数据处理
- 深入学习推荐系统:教程、案例与项目实践
- Web开发者必备的取色工具软件介绍
- C语言实现李春葆数据结构实验程序
- 超市管理系统开发:asp+SQL Server 2005实战
- Redis伪集群搭建教程与实践
- 掌握网络活动细节:Wireshark v3.6.3网络嗅探工具详解
- 全面掌握美赛:建模、分析与编程实现教程
- Java图书馆系统完整项目源码及SQL文件解析
- PCtoLCD2002软件:高效图片和字符取模转换
- Java开发的体育赛事在线购票系统源码分析